TP-Link's Archer VR900 universal modem router

If there is such a thing as a universal modem router, the Archer VR900 from TP-Link is it. It has 2.4/5GHz wireless connectivity and is compatible with ADSL and VDSL standards as well fibre, cable and 3G/4G USB dongles.

TP-Link Archer VR900 review

The Archer VR900 is the ADSL modem-equipped version of TP-Link's Archer C9 , one of the best cable-only 802.11ac routers I've seen. TP-Link Archer VR900

Which is the most important tech device in your home? Looking beyond what's likely to be an array of frivolous gadgets, it's safe to say that the core essentials are what matter most - the boiler, the oven and the kettle (I'm standing by that one).
Pros:
  • Works with any Internet connection
  • Simple setup process
  • Good wireless performance
  • 4x Gigabit Ethernet
  • USB 3.0 storage sharing
  • Optional 3G/4G backup
Cons:
  • Manual firmware updates
  • Pricey at £140
